Poshan Pakhwada 2021



A dietician Ms Anupreksha Rastogi was invite by the NSS Unit of the Government College of Education, Chandigarh as a part of the ongoing activities on the POSHAN PAKHWADA 2021 drive of the Government of India and much reinforced by the NSS units of the Education Department Chandigarh. The one hour webinar was based on the topic ‘Breakfast Power-Be a Pro.’ The webinar was opened by Dr. Ravneet Chawla (Associate Professor and NSS Programme Officer) of the college. The principal of the college, Dr. A. K. Srivastava, formally welcomed the speaker of the day who is a Visiting Diet Consultant to many hospitals. Ms. Shivangi, student coordinator, moderated the session. The highlight of the webinar was demonstrations. Dt. Anupreksha Rastogi virtually demonstrated various healthy recipes to the students using different nutritious seeds, home based improvised dairy products like hung curd a s base for sandwiches, and using sprouts and boiled things which need to big time to prepare.  Dt. Rastogi readily shared the recipes of various breakfast dishes. The interactive session was further carried on with the questions of both the students and the faculty members that further enhanced knowledge on gym like life style and eating patterns, importance of fasting and it’s precautions, ned of customizing diets than going by general rules for people with chronic health issues and allergies, and how a balanced diet can be applied to breakfast also.
